Ultimately, the choice comes down to the end: do you kill the antagonist, or do you consume his essence? If you opt to drain Ambrus’s blood, you unlock the potent Scarlet Shield vampiric ability, a powerful gift that rewards the bold. This choice brings with it not only incredible power but also the tantalizing option of inviting Ambrus into your life, a decision that carries its own unique weight.

Conversely, slaying him grants you the spoils—his legendary armor set and sword—but bypasses this vampiric transformation.
